如果我有3个Wi-Fi点(或更多),我无法找到有关使用三角测量找到我的位置的任何正确信息 我有3个Wi-Fi接入点。我有lat和long(lat1,long1,lat2,long2,lat3,long 3) 在应用程序中我扫描这些点并尝试使用以下公式计算距离:
public double calculateDistance(double signal, double freq) {
double exp = (27.55 - (20 * Math.log10(freq)) + Math.abs(signal)) / 20.0;
return Math.pow(10.0, exp);
}
基于频率(mHz)和信号强度。因为信号不好所以距离的结果很奇怪。 当我有3项距离(例如10米,100米和70米)并且我有纬度/长度的Wi-Fi接入点 - 我如何计算我的位置?拜托,任何人都可以告诉我。关于互联网上的大量信息 - 但只有单词。 Lat / Long - 需要转换为普通坐标吗? (x,y)是的 - 以米为单位的距离怎么样?如果有一个点有50,50和距离= 70美元。有关它的任何有用信息吗?